In every industry—from software development to woodworking, from graphic design to surgery—there’s an ongoing debate: Does formal training define a true professional, or can raw talent and self-taught skill surpass even the most credentialed experts? The distinction between a profession and a craft isn’t always clear. One implies structure, accreditation, and standardized knowledge; the other evokes intuition, experience, and hands-on mastery. But in practice, the lines blur. What matters most isn’t the path taken, but the outcome delivered.
The Nature of Profession: Structure, Standards, and Accountability
A profession is typically defined by formal education, licensing, ethical codes, and institutional oversight. Doctors, lawyers, architects, and engineers follow structured curricula, pass rigorous exams, and adhere to regulatory bodies. This system exists to ensure consistency, safety, and public trust. Formal training provides a shared language, foundational principles, and exposure to edge cases that might take years to encounter independently.
Yet, professionalism isn’t just about credentials—it’s about accountability. A licensed architect doesn’t just know how to design buildings; they understand building codes, liability, and long-term structural integrity. Their training includes not only technical skills but also ethics, collaboration, and risk management. These are rarely taught through trial and error alone.
“Formal education doesn’t make you competent—it gives you the framework to become competent.” — Dr. Lena Torres, Educational Psychologist
The Power of Craft: Mastery Through Practice and Intuition
Craft, on the other hand, is rooted in doing. A master carpenter may never have attended trade school but has spent decades refining joints, understanding wood grain, and reading the subtle signs of material fatigue. A self-taught programmer might lack a computer science degree but can build elegant, scalable applications through relentless experimentation.
Craftsmanship thrives on repetition, observation, and adaptation. It values results over resumes. Many legendary creators—Leonardo da Vinci, Muddy Waters, Steve Jobs—were either minimally formally trained or entirely self-directed. Their genius emerged not from classrooms, but from obsession, curiosity, and deep immersion.
The craftsperson often develops a personal methodology—a signature rhythm, a unique problem-solving style—that can’t be replicated in a syllabus. Where formal training standardizes, craft individualizes.
Comparing Paths: When Training Matters and When Skill Prevails
Not all fields treat formal training equally. In some, skipping the traditional path is feasible—or even advantageous. In others, it’s dangerous or impossible.
| Field | Can Skill Alone Succeed? | Risks of Bypassing Training | Examples |
|---|---|---|---|
| Software Development | Yes, frequently | Limited system design knowledge, gaps in security | Mark Zuckerberg (Harvard dropout), many bootcamp grads |
| Medicine | No | Patient harm, legal consequences | Must be licensed; no exceptions |
| Graphic Design | Yes, common | Less understanding of branding systems | Pablo Ferro, Paula Scher (self-taught elements) |
| Music Performance | Yes, often | Technical limitations, injury risk | Jimi Hendrix, Prince, Ella Fitzgerald |
| Civil Engineering | No | Structural failure, public danger | Requires licensure and peer review |
This table illustrates a key truth: the necessity of formal training correlates directly with consequence. When human lives, infrastructure, or large-scale systems are at stake, standardized knowledge becomes non-negotiable. In creative or rapidly evolving domains, raw skill and adaptability often close—or even eliminate—the gap.
Real-World Example: The Self-Taught Surgeon Who Wasn’t
In 2013, a man in New Jersey performed surgeries—including liposuction and breast augmentations—without a medical license. He had studied videos, read textbooks, and practiced on cadavers. Some patients reported satisfaction. But when complications arose, he lacked the diagnostic depth to respond. Several suffered permanent damage.
This case underscores a critical boundary: while self-education can yield impressive results, it cannot replicate the breadth of clinical training—especially in crisis response, anatomy variation, and pharmacology. Skill without systemic understanding is fragile.
Contrast this with James Dyson, who built 5,127 prototypes before perfecting his bagless vacuum. No formal engineering degree compelled him, but he studied fluid dynamics, materials science, and manufacturing processes deeply. His craft was informed by research, not defiance of it. He didn’t reject learning—he redefined how he accessed it.
Bridging the Gap: The Hybrid Path to Mastery
The most effective professionals today often blend both worlds. They respect formal frameworks but remain agile learners. Consider modern apprenticeships in tech, where coding bootcamps (structured but accelerated) replace four-year degrees for some roles. Or culinary schools that emphasize hands-on kitchen time alongside food safety certification.
The ideal path isn’t “school vs. street”—it’s intentional learning, wherever it comes from. A web developer might earn a CS degree, then spend nights building open-source tools. A furniture maker might apprentice under a master, then audit engineering courses to improve joinery precision.
Step-by-Step: Building Credibility Without Traditional Credentials
- Identify Core Knowledge Gaps: Use job postings, industry standards, or mentor feedback to pinpoint missing fundamentals.
- Curate a Learning Plan: Combine free courses (Coursera, edX), books, and practical projects.
- Build a Portfolio: Showcase real work, not just theory. A designer’s portfolio matters more than their diploma.
- Seek Feedback from Experts: Join communities, attend meetups, or find mentors willing to critique your work.
- Earn Micro-Credentials: Certifications like Google Analytics, AWS Cloud Practitioner, or Adobe Certified Professional add legitimacy.
- Document Your Process: Blogging or vlogging about challenges and solutions builds authority over time.

FAQ
Can you be a professional without formal training?
Yes, in many fields—but you must compensate with verifiable skill, consistent output, and credibility-building efforts like certifications, publications, or peer recognition. However, regulated professions (e.g., medicine, law) legally require formal credentials.
Does a degree guarantee better performance?
No. A degree signals exposure to foundational knowledge and discipline, but performance depends on application, curiosity, and continuous improvement. Many highly educated individuals stagnate; many self-taught ones excel through relentless practice.
How do employers view self-taught candidates?
It varies. Tech and creative industries often prioritize portfolios and problem-solving ability over degrees. Traditional sectors (finance, government) may still filter by education. Networking, referrals, and demonstrable results can overcome initial skepticism.
Conclusion: Mastery Is the True Credential
The divide between profession and craft is narrowing. In a world where information is accessible and innovation moves fast, rigid hierarchies based solely on credentials are fading. What endures is the ability to deliver value—to solve problems, create beauty, and improve systems.
Formal training offers a proven roadmap. Craft offers authenticity and adaptability. The wisest practitioners borrow from both. They respect the foundations but aren’t bound by them. They learn continuously, measure themselves by results, and let their work speak louder than their résumé.
